BusyBumbleTots classes start in Notting Hill on 16th April

BusyBumbleTots classes start in Notting Hill next week, aiming to introduce unique and fun filled classes to West London parents and their toddlers!

Each term, the weekly classes will rotate through one of four different subjects – yoga, arts and crafts, music and cooking – offering up a far more entertaining way for both children and their parents to enjoy this kind of class. Suitable for children aged between 18 months and 3 years, classes are presented in a fun and stimulating environment and are taught by professionals.

The very first BusyBumbleTots class will take place on 16th April with arts and crafts as its theme. The first class will be absolutely free, which is a great opportunity for parents to learn more about the BusyBumbleTots concept and to see if it’s right for their child.

BusyBumbleTots is the brainchild of Saskia Hayward, an experience child minder, crèche owner and mother to a little girl. Having undertaken extensive research to find classes in West London that offer a range of fun subjects within a one term course, Saskia found that none existed…so decided to start her own!

Classes will be held every Tuesday during term time at either 2pm – 2.45pm or 3pm to 3.45pm. Twenty places are available but they do get booked quickly, so book early to avoid disappointment!
